The gentle hues of pastels bring a sense of calmness and elegance, making them ideal for various spaces within the home. From living rooms to bedrooms, pastel shades can be seamlessly integrated with traditional Indian decor elements, enhancing the visual appeal while maintaining cultural significance.Incorporating pastel colors into your home can be done in various ways. For instance, painting walls in soft shades of mint green, baby pink, or sky blue can create a fresh backdrop. Pairing these colors with wooden furniture or traditional Indian textiles can add warmth and character to the space. Adding pastel-colored accessories such as cushions, rugs, and curtains can also help in achieving a harmonious look without overwhelming the space.Tips for Pastel Interior Design:1. **Choose a Color Palette:** Select a few pastel shades that complement each other. Popular combinations include mint with peach, lavender with soft yellow, or pale blue with cream.2. **Focus on Lighting:** Ensure that the lighting in your space enhances the pastel colors. Natural light works beautifully with these shades, so consider sheer curtains to maximize brightness.3. **Mix Textures:** Combine different textures such as soft fabrics, woven materials, and smooth finishes to create visual interest while keeping the color palette cohesive.4. **Incorporate Traditional Elements:** Add Indian decor items like hand-painted ceramics, wooden carvings, or ethnic wall hangings to maintain a cultural connection.FAQWhat are the benefits of using pastel colors in Indian home interiors?Pastel colors can create a serene and inviting atmosphere, making spaces feel larger and more open. They also complement traditional decor while adding a modern touch.How can I incorporate pastels without overwhelming the space?Start with a neutral base and add pastel accents through furniture, artwork, and accessories.
